What they do

THE CONNECTICUT PLAYERS FOUNDATION, INC. D/B/A LONG WHARF THEATRE (THE ORGANIZATION") is A NOT-FOR-PROFIT CORPORATION LOCATED IN NEW HAVEN, CONNECTICUT. FOUNDED IN 1965, ITS MISSION is to PRODUCE BOUNDARY-BREAKING THEATRE WITH and for ITS MANY KALEIDOSCOPIC COMMUNITIES. OVER 60 YEARS, LONG WHARF THEATRE HAS GIVEN NEW VITALITY to THE AMERICAN DRAMATIC CANON BY PRODUCING CLASSIC PLAYS, COMMISSIONING NEW WORKS, and PREMIERING MORE THAN 100 PLAYS and MUSICALS. MANY PRODUCTIONS INCUBATED AT LONG WHARF THEATRE HAVE GONE to HAVE LIFE ON BROADWAY, OFF-BROADWAY, and AT THEATRES ACROSS THE COUNTRY, INCLUDING THE PULITZER PRICE-WINNING THE GINE GAME, THE SHADOW BOX, and WIT. THE COMPANYS WORK HAS BEEN RECOGNIZED TONY, NEW YORK DRAMA CRITICS CIRCLE AWARDS; A MARGO JONES AWARD for THE PRODUCTION of NEW WORK; and NOMINATIONS and CONNECTICUT CRITICS CIRCLE AWARDS IN NEARLY EVERY CATEGORY.
